The length of a rectangle is 2 cm more than four times the width. If the perimeter of the rectangle is 84 cm, what are its dimen
katovenus [111]

Answer:

Length 34 cm

Width 8 cm

Step-by-step explanation:

Let

x-----> the length of the rectangle

y----> the width of the rectangle

we know that

The perimeter of rectangle is equal to

P=2(x+y)

P=84 cm

so

84=2(x+y)

42=x+y ----> equation A

x=4y+2 -----> equation B

substitute equation B in equation A and solve for y

42=(4y+2)+y

5y=42-2

y=40/5=8 cm

Find the value of x

x=4y+2 ----> x=4(8)+2=34 cm

The dimensions are

Length 34 cm

Width 8 cm

A robot moving forward at a constant speed takes 2.5 hours to travel 1 kilometer. Moving forward at this same constant speed, it
makvit [3.9K]

Answer:

The length of the hallway is 10 m.

Step-by-step explanation:

Given:

Time taken to cover 1 km = 2.5 hours

Distance covered in 2.5 hours = 1 km

Therefore, speed of robot = \frac{\textrm{Distance}}{\textrm{TIme}}=\frac{1}{2.5}=0.4\ km/h

Now, speed is constant.

Now, time taken to cover the length of hallway = 90 s

Speed of the robot = 0.4 km/h

Converting 0.4 km/h to m/s, we multiply by the factor \frac{5}{18}. This gives,

0.4\times \frac{5}{18}=\frac{1}{9}\ m/s

Now, distance of the hallway is equal to the product of speed and time. So,

Distance of hallway = Speed \times Time

Distance of hallway = \frac{1}{9}\times 90=\frac{90}{9}=10\ m

Therefore, the length of the hallway is 10 m.
